I guess I'll give it a shot and buy the one that I linked to. However... I just realized that it doesn't mention "HO" (for high output I guess) anywhere, like some of the T5 ballasts do. Is this a bad thing?

theatrus
08/26/2006, 02:13 PM
Its probably not rated for running HO lamps then... But if you match up the watts right it should run them fine :)
